A scalable metabolite supplementation strategy against antibiotic resistant pathogen Chromobacterium violaceum induced by NAD+/NADH+ imbalance.
BMC systems biology - 26 Apr 2017
Banerjee Deepanwita, Parmar Dharmeshkumar, Bhattacharya Nivedita, Ghanate Avinash D, Panchagnula Venkateswarlu, Raghunathan Anu
Abstract excerpt
BACKGROUND: The leading edge of the global problem of antibiotic resistance necessitates novel therapeutic strategies. This study develops a novel systems biology driven approach for killing antibiotic resistant pathogens using benign metabolites. RESULTS: Controlled laboratory evolutions established chloramphenicol and streptomycin resistant pathogens of Chromobacterium. These resistant pathogens showed higher...
